Section IV. National Stock Number and Part Number Index. A list, in National Item Identification Number
(NIIN) sequence, of all national stock numbered items appearing in the listing, followed by a list in alphanumeric
sequence of all part numbers appearing in the listings. National stock numbers and part numbers are cross-referenced to
each illustration figure and item number appearance.

Explanation of Columns (Sections II and III).
a.
ITEM NO. (Column (1). Indicates the number used to identify items called out in the illustration.
b.
SMR CODE (Column (2). The Source, Maintenance, and Recoverability (SMR) code is a 5-position code
containing supply/requisitioning information, maintenance category authorization criteria, and disposition instruction, as
shown in the following breakout:

*Complete Repair: Maintenance capacity, capability, and authority to perform all corrective maintenance tasks of the
"Repair" function in a use/user environment in order to restore serviceability to a failed item.
(1)
Source Code. The source code tells you how to get an item needed for maintenance, repair, or overhaul of
an end item/equipment. Explanations of source codes follows:
